Infernal Secrets

Rate this book
"Once you spin the wheel of fate, you cannot undo what you set in motion."

I thought nightmares ended when you woke up.
Turns out, mine were just waiting for me to open my eyes.

Thirteen years ago, I saw something the night my parents died no one would believe. Grandma said the monsters were real, but everyone called her crazy like Mom. And after a lifetime of seeing things I’d never admit to, I feared I was losing my mind too… until four men appeared in my house after I opened a book I never should’ve touched.

They’re beautiful. Dangerous. And definitely not human.
Ash, Cyn, Zeke, and Ezra—demon princes trapped on Earth by my mistake.

Helping them find a way home means facing both the darkness that destroyed my family and the mysterious pull between us.

Each of them tempts me in different ways:
Ash, the wounded protector who makes me feel seen.
Zeke, the broken soul who awakens my own need to protect.
Ezra, the ice prince who watches me like I’m both threat and prey.
And Cyn, the magnetic asshole that I shouldn’t want, but I do.

The closer we get to the truth about my bloodline, the clearer it becomes that our connection runs deeper than desire.

Some fates aren’t chosen. Some fates are written in blood.

••••••••••••••••••••••••••••••••••

Author's Note: Infernal Secrets is the first book in the Elyrdin Fate trilogy and is in first person, multiple POV. This story will not be completed in book one and contains some scenes that readers may find challenging such as dark and sensitive themes. Intended for readers 18+. To learn more about content in the author's work, please visit her website.

Elyrdin Fate is a polyamorous romance between one woman and four men (MMFMM), including MF, MM, and group scenes where no one has to choose.

Stephanie Denne is a #1 international bestselling author of paranormal romance with a focus on mental health and trauma healing ranging from light to dark. Born in the United States, Stephanie now calls Ontario, Canada her home. When not writing, she can be found reading her favorite stories, playing video games with her husband, painting and drawing, or cuddling her Golden Retrievers. Infernal Secrets by Stephanie Denne absolutely hooks you from the first page with a compelling heroine, charismatic demon princes, and a richly imagined paranormal world that I truly couldn’t get enough of. To say I could hardly put it down was an understatement. It’s a dark, compelling paranormal romance that leans heavily into atmosphere, emotional tension, and slow-burn intrigue. The blend of destined fate, desire, and danger creates a page-turning read that balances romance and mythic intrigue.

One of the book’s strongest elements that I found myself most connected to was its characters, their relationships, and their overall growth. The protagonist feels grounded and emotionally believable, relatable, particularly in how she responds to the unraveling of her reality. Rather than rushing into confidence, her growth unfolds gradually, which makes her arc feel earned. The romantic dynamics are layered and intentional, emphasizing connection, power balance, and trust over instant gratification. The men are to die for — each so different in their own ways, but so alluringly different but complimenting to one another.

The story also excels in tone and pacing; honestly, the point at which the book shines most after its characters. It was the perfect combination to leave you wanting more while making it so memorable. Denne maintains a steady sense of momentum while allowing room for introspection and relationship development, the perfect recipe for a meaningful story. The mythology is introduced in digestible pieces, creating intrigue without overwhelming the reader, and leaving a clear promise for deeper exploration as the series continues. The elements Denne used in this story are a refreshing take on demons, the underworld and paranormal reality. And while the book leans into familiar paranormal romance tropes that we tend to all know and love, it uses them effectively and focuses on emotional stakes rather than shock value.

Overall, Infernal Secrets is a strong series opener that prioritizes mood, character chemistry, and long-term storytelling.
